What affects the price

Electricians determine their rates based on several key factors. First, the complexity of the task matters; replacing a simple outlet is much faster than upgrading an entire electrical panel or rewiring a room. The accessibility of the work area also plays a role, as jobs in cramped attics or crawl spaces often require more time and labor. Additionally, the age of your home’s existing wiring can impact how much work is needed to meet current safety codes.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

About this service

You need an emergency electrician when you face an immediate safety risk, such as sparking wires, total power loss, or burning odors coming from outlets. These professionals are available outside of standard business hours to stabilize your home and prevent fire hazards. If you feel your electrical system is posing an immediate threat to your household, do not wait until morning to get help. Prioritize your safety and contact a professional who can provide a rapid response to urgent situations.
